Output 4e8de1021d7ede31c102c07d45a8a14302c2c4aa93bd21f415cd1bf323c5b059:1

value
3764415622
script pubkey
OP_0 OP_PUSHBYTES_20 18b871ed194d0d6b05fad28fb2d59c05dfb539c3
address
tb1qrzu8rmgef5xkkp06628m94vuqh0m2wwrmpjf4z
transaction
4e8de1021d7ede31c102c07d45a8a14302c2c4aa93bd21f415cd1bf323c5b059
confirmations
42591
spent
true